Full job description

Employment Type: Part timeShift: 12 Hour Day Shift Description: Position Purpose: Registered Nurse – Critical Care Unit RN works in a collaborative environment at St Mary’s Health Care System to deliver excellent patient care as part of an interdisciplinary team providing evidence-based medicine and individualized patient care. A Registered Nurse RN is expected to facilitate all aspects of the patient visit experience. Great opportunity for a Registered Nurse RN professional to work in an organization that focuses on treating the whole person, physically, emotionally, and spiritually.

What you will do:

  • Critical Care has two units: Intensive Care Unit and Neuro Intensive Care Unit. We are on the cutting edge of interventional stroke care and changing lives every day in our community. We offer growth and development as all staff are trained to work on both units.
  • Under limited supervision, the Registered Nurse is responsible for assessing patients, including developing, evaluating, and modifying the care plan. The RN interprets and performs complex patient-care procedures specific to their expertise.
  • RNs are members of the Care Team and Support Team and have accountability to function as a team to accomplish patient outcomes identified in the pathway/plan of care.
  • The Registered Nurse is a professional caregiver who assumes responsibility and accountability for the care given to a group of patients for a designated time frame.
  • The RN provides care to those patients via therapeutic use of self, the nursing process, the environment/technology, and other healthcare team members, according to established standards.

Minimum Qualifications:

  • A current license to practice as a Registered Nurse in the State of Georgia.
  • Graduation from an accredited nursing education program approved by the Board of Nursing or found by the Board to be substantially equivalent to the programs in Georgia.
  • Successful completion of a refresher course within the past 6 months if nursing practice has not occurred within the past 5 years.
